I set 2Facotr authentication as mandatory as shown below.
Our organization uses Azure AD to log in.
when we first log in, we enter the 2-factor authentication step.
but, if we are logged in automatically, skip the steps above and log in.
Can't we force the authentication step every time we enter Jira ?
Hello @ChangSoo Yoon
1) If you are logging with SSO (the 1st option in the screenshot) via Azure AD then the 2FA is done on Azure AD side, not Atlassian Cloud.
Please note clicking on "Continue with Microsoft" is not SSO in terms of Atlassian, it's just a convenient "shortcut".
2) Does your 2FA screen actually have Atlassian's logo at the top? Like this:
If not – then you are entering 2FA on Azure AD side, and the setting to do it every time or only once has to be set on Azure AD side
3) Can you clarify what exactly happens when you "are logged in automatically"? You click on the link in your email or open browser and type Jira URL directly, and then what happens? What is the next screen you see?
I suspect you are not actually "logged in" you just allowed access based on the cookies that are still valid.
4) Clearly you have Atlassian Access, since you are configuring billable features in the user policy – the last setting in your screenshot is the session validity. You could reduce this to some small value. Please note however, that very short values WILL affect behaviour e.g. Jira issue create screen will timeout after the session becomes invalid.
